Transaction 95e7127786558fc875b4fce24b5bd88f34c26d8eb46f38aa20aa380088e356fc
1 Input
1 Output
-
95e7127786558fc875b4fce24b5bd88f34c26d8eb46f38aa20aa380088e356fc:0
- value
- 9257452
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 021443728626991762f3a0178c6a15a1e448dc27 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BzdKDDxaizSNDHehRxFHauzjiuUmrAvW